## Ownership

This repository replaces the homegrown job queue formerly embedded in the Tallowfield monolith. Migration happened incrementally: workers were ported first, then schedulers, then the retry layer. Legacy queue tables still exist in production but are read-only; do not delete them until the archive job finishes its final pass. Future maintainers should assume anything undocumented here is intentional. Questions about design decisions and deprecation timelines go to the current owner.

named custodian: Brivan Eliath Quenox Frador

Ticket: drift detected on the Fernbolt firmware update channel. Plugin authors, please note this carefully: the beta channel's rollout percentage and signing policy no longer match what the Halcyard console displays, because a hotfix last month edited the channel directly rather than through the manifest pipeline. Until reconciliation completes, treat the console as unreliable and validate against the actual channel values, which currently read as follows.

config for kafof-bawef:
holath:
  log_level: debug
  metrics_host: metrics.holath.qorvelsys.internal
  pin: 2191
  pool_size: 32

- [ ] Ceremony step 3: before rotating the Farrow & Lark signing keys, pause the ticket-pricing experiment (the "dynamic matinee" one) so price variants don't get signed with stale keys mid-test. New folks: yes, this matters — a half-signed experiment config corrupted results last spring. Resume the experiment only after quorum sign-off. To unlock the experiment controls during the freeze, use the recovery passphrase, which is:

unlock words, hahip-baduf: holwyn-istath-julvan